Verify before you trust the introduction
A professional agent should make verification easy. Before sharing documents or money, confirm who the agent works for, what property they are authorised to market, and where payments should legally go.
Checks to complete
- Ask for the agent's full name, agency name, office address, phone number, and email.
- Contact the agency through a number you find independently, not only the number sent by the agent.
- Ask for the mandate or confirmation that the agent is authorised to market the property.
- Compare the property details across the listing, agency, owner, and viewing.
- Be careful if payment instructions go to a personal account without explanation.
- Keep written records of viewings, offers, deposits, commissions, and receipts.
Scammers borrow real names
Someone can claim to work for a known agency. Verify through independent contact details before trusting documents, payment requests, or urgent instructions.
